Tasting notes

A generous and elegant wine. Light golden colour. Intense nose of flower, brioche and candied lemon aromas, evolving towards nuances of grilled hazelnut and spice as the wine matures. On the palate, the wine is straightforward, with a nice texture and finesse. It has a long aftertaste where floral and gingerbread notes dominate.

Vinification

Very slow pressing so as to respect fruit. Fermentation under strict temperature control. No added yeasts or enzymes are used. The wine goes directly into barrels after decanting it to reduce sediment.

Ageing

In French oak barrels (25% new) for 12 months.

Food pairing

Excellent as an aperitif or paired with lobsters or other seafood, a variety of cheeses, baked trout or delicate chicken dishes.
